GIS Analyst II

Trinity Global Consulting
Littleton, CO Full Time

Duties May Include:

  • Implement analytical techniques necessary to solve recurring, procedural, and factual geospatial and GIS issues including identifying data needs for specific projects, determining compatibility with other platforms, and locating missing information
  • Administer geospatial databases and implement quality control and quality assurance guidelines for geospatial data projects
  • Participate on interdisciplinary teams with various stakeholders such as other federal agencies, Regional Geospatial Coordinators, and other BIA divisions on various mapping projects
  • Apply knowledge of geographic and cartographic sciences, interdisciplinary resource management, and database management to administer geospatial databases
  • Utilize knowledge of appropriate database design principles to identify interrelationships within GIS data and ensure data integrity
  • Apply knowledge of standardized geospatial and GIS software/hardware applicable to BIA and tribal government operations
  • Develop basic GIS applications and dashboards at the request of BIA leadership to support decision-making and program management
  • Develop and maintain metadata for all GIS projects for the Division in compliance with FGDC standards

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in Geographic Information Systems, Geography, Environmental Science, Natural Resources, or related field
  • Minimum 3-5 years of experience in GIS analysis, mapping, and geospatial database administration
  • Proficiency with ESRI ArcGIS Pro and ArcGIS Desktop software suite
  • Experience with geospatial database administration including geodatabase design and maintenance
  • Knowledge of cartographic principles and map production techniques
  • Understanding of spatial analysis methods and geoprocessing tools
  • Experience creating and editing metadata in compliance with FGDC standards
  • Basic scripting or programming skills (Python preferred) for GIS automation
  • Strong problem-solving skills and ability to troubleshoot geospatial data issues
  • Effective communication skills and ability to work on interdisciplinary teams
  • Ability to pass background check with no DWI convictions within last 10 years and no crimes against children
  • U.S. Citizenship or Lawful Permanent Residency

Desired Qualifications:

  • Master's degree in GIS, Geography, or related field
  • GISP (GIS Professional) certification or progress toward certification
  • ESRI Technical Certification in ArcGIS Desktop or Enterprise
  • Experience with ArcGIS Online and web-based GIS applications
  • Knowledge of SQL and relational database management systems
  • Experience developing dashboards using ArcGIS Dashboards or similar platforms
  • Familiarity with natural resource management, forestry, or environmental applications
  • Experience working with federal agencies or tribal governments
  • Knowledge of federal data standards including NSDI and DOI requirements
  • Understanding of land management systems, cadastral data, or Public Land Survey System
  • Experience with remote sensing data processing and analysis
  • Familiarity with project management principles and tools
  • Technical writing skills and ability to create documentation and user guides
